Measurement

Spencer Thursfield & Lindsay Smith · Last reviewed 2026-08

Nearly everything in AI SEO that deserves the word "known" came from measurement. This pillar covers what a small business, or anyone, can observe: crawler visits, referral clicks, prompt-set results, citation patterns. It is also where this site publishes its own instruments and findings, because we hold ourselves to the standard we describe.

  • Measure the pipeline as separate stages. Retrieval, citation, answer influence and real custom are different outcomes; collapsing them into one number destroys the information. Strongly supported
  • Your server logs already contain evidence: which AI crawlers fetch your pages, verified against the operators' published identities. GA-style analytics cannot see this. Strongly supported
  • You can count ChatGPT referrals. OpenAI tags applicable referral links with utm_source=chatgpt.com. Official recommendation
  • Repetition is mandatory. A single-run prompt check measures noise. Our protocol runs every question repeatedly, in fresh sessions, and reports the variation. Strongly supported
